Protecting Your Family from Lead Contamination
As you pour yourself a glass of water from the tap, the metallic taste that tinges the drink might be a warning sign. If your home has older plumbing, it could be time to take action. Lead contamination can seep into drinking water through corroded pipes or fixtures, posing serious health risks, particularly for children.
Identifying the Problem: How Lead Enters Your Home
Lead can infiltrate your home in various ways, primarily through:
- Old lead pipes that may be present in homes built before the 1980s.
- Lead solder used in plumbing joints.
- Fixtures and fittings containing lead, particularly in older models.
It's essential to remain vigilant about these sources, especially if you live in an older home. Any signs of corrosion, such as discoloration around faucets or pipe joints, could be indicators of potential lead presence in your water supply.

Effective Treatment Solutions for Lead Contamination
When it comes to treating lead in your water, several technologies are effective:
- Reverse Osmosis Systems: This technology uses a semi-permeable membrane to remove lead and other contaminants from water. It's known for producing high-quality drinking water.
- Activated Carbon Filters: While effective in removing some lead, it's essential that these filters are specifically designed to target heavy metals. They work by trapping contaminants as water passes through the filter.
- Water Softeners: Although primarily used to reduce hardness minerals, certain models can help reduce lead levels if properly configured and maintained.
Choosing the Right Size and Capacity
When selecting equipment, it's important to consider factors such as:
- Flow Rate: Ensure that the system can handle your household's peak usage. Systems may vary in the gallons per minute (GPM) they can process.
- Grain Capacity: For water softeners, this refers to the total amount of hardness and contaminant removal the system can achieve before regeneration.
- Gallons Per Day (GPD): For reverse osmosis systems, check the GPD rating to ensure you have enough purified water for drinking and cooking needs.
- Tank Size: Evaluate the physical size of the equipment to ensure it fits conveniently in your home.

Types of Lead Treatment Systems
There are various types of lead treatment systems available, each designed to target lead contamination in different ways. Understanding these options can help you choose the most effective solution for your home.
Point-of-Use Systems
Point-of-use (POU) systems are installed at specific taps, such as kitchen sinks. They effectively filter out lead and other contaminants directly before use. These systems are ideal for households looking for a convenient solution that doesn't require extensive plumbing modifications.
Point-of-Entry Systems
Point-of-entry (POE) systems treat all the water entering the home. This comprehensive approach ensures that lead is removed from all faucets, including showers and washing machines. While more expensive and larger than POU systems, POE systems provide broader protection against lead contamination.
Filtration Technologies
Different filtration technologies can be utilized in lead treatment systems, including:
- Activated Carbon Filters: These filters are effective at adsorbing lead and other contaminants, making them a popular choice in both POU and POE systems.
- Reverse Osmosis: This technology forces water through a semipermeable membrane to remove lead and other impurities, producing high-quality purified water.
- Distillation: Involves heating water to create steam and then cooling it to collect purified water, effectively removing lead but requiring more energy and time.
